Abstract

The application provides a connector cable waterproof covering structure, which comprises a connector, a connecting outer cylinder, a rubber sleeve and a sleeve cylinder. The connector is connected with a cable. The connecting outer cylinder is arranged around the outer periphery of the cable and is assembled and fixed at the end of the connector. The sleeve cylinder is buckled to the connecting outer cylinder to stably connect the connector with the cable. The buckle section of the connecting outer cylinder is formed with a plurality of elastic buckling pieces by using the slot. The rubber sleeve is assembled along the cable and is arranged in the inner diameter of the buckle section by using the non-cylindrical shaft hole design characteristics of the rubber sleeve. When the buckle section is expanded by the rubber sleeve, the sleeve cylinder can be buckled tightly by the expanded buckle section when the sleeve cylinder covers the buckle section and is buckled and fixed, so that the cable is prevented from being separated from the connector.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present invention relates to a cable connector, in particular to a waterproof structure of a connector cable. BACKGROUND

[0002] Nowadays, the existing connectors are gradually widely and commonly used in outdoor places, so the waterproof effect of the connector is increasingly required. Most of the connectors are made of metal materials with good conductivity for signal transmission, and the metal materials are easily dampened to damage the transmission function or even lose the function. Although there are some products on the market specially for the connector moisture-proof structure, the waterproof effect is still not ideal.

[0003] An existing connector includes a plurality of conductive terminals, an insulating seat, a cable and a covering body. The conductive terminals are fixed in the insulating seat. The cable has a plurality of core wires, and each core wire is connected to each conductive terminal. The covering body covers the conductive terminals, the insulating seat and the cable. However, the covering body is easily failed to be injected and covered on the insulating seat and the cable due to the mold or the structure tolerance, which causes the whole connector to be scrapped and increases the cost. Since the insulating seat is a hard material and the covering body is a soft material, the two materials need to be tightly attached to each other to achieve the waterproof effect. However, after a period of use, the two materials will gradually generate gaps and peel off due to the large difference in physical properties, which causes water vapor to penetrate and makes the conductive terminals damp and reduces their efficiency. Therefore, how to improve the production yield of the connector, how to make the connector achieve the waterproof effect, and how to improve the overall structural strength and durability of the connector have become the research topics of the present invention. SUMMARY

[0004] The present invention aims to solve the above-mentioned problems in the prior art and provides a buckle type waterproof structure of a connector cable.

[0005] The connector cable waterproof covering structure comprises a connector connected to a cable; a connecting outer cylinder arranged around the outer periphery of the cable and assembled and fixed to the end of the connector, and the end of the connecting outer cylinder away from the connector forms a buckle section, the buckle section is provided with a plurality of split grooves along the axial direction at the end, and the buckle section forms a plurality of elastic buckling pieces, and the outer surface of the elastic buckling pieces is provided with a plurality of buckle ribs along the radial direction; a rubber sleeve, the inner diameter of the rubber sleeve forms a non-cylindrical shaft sleeve hole, one end of the outer diameter of the rubber sleeve is provided with a connecting section, the upper end of the connecting section is provided with a leak-proof section, the outer diameter of the leak-proof section is larger than the outer diameter of the connecting section, and the inner diameter of the shaft sleeve hole at the position opposite to the leak-proof section is smaller than the inner diameter at the position opposite to the connecting section, the rubber sleeve is tightly sleeved on the outer periphery of the cable through the shaft sleeve hole, and the connecting section is assembled into the inner diameter of the buckle section of the connecting outer cylinder, the non-cylindrical design characteristic of the shaft sleeve hole enables the outer diameter of the rubber sleeve to be further stretched outward when the rubber sleeve is sleeved on the cable, the elastic buckling pieces of the connecting outer cylinder are further pushed out, and the leak-proof section is abutted against the end of the connecting outer cylinder; a sleeve cylinder is buckled and combined with the connecting outer cylinder through the cable, and a plurality of buckle grooves are arranged on the inner and outer diameter surfaces of the bottom end of the sleeve cylinder, and the sleeve cylinder is buckled and fixed with the buckle ribs of the connecting outer cylinder through the buckle grooves, so that the sleeve cylinder and the connecting outer cylinder can be tightly matched through the characteristic that the elastic buckling pieces of the connecting outer cylinder are pushed out by the rubber sleeve stretched outward.

[0006] Preferably, the inner diameter of the buckle section of the connecting outer cylinder forms an expanded hole and has a step, so that the inner diameter of the buckle section and the cable have a combined ring groove.

[0007] Preferably, the upper end of the leak-proof section of the rubber sleeve forms a sleeve section, the outer diameter of the sleeve section is smaller than the outer diameter of the leak-proof section, and the upper half of the sleeve section is provided with a buckling ring groove, and the upper end of the buckling ring groove further forms a guide section with an outer diameter smaller than the sleeve section.

[0008] Preferably, it further comprises a tightening ring, a plurality of split grooves are arranged at equal intervals on the periphery of the tightening ring, and a plurality of tightening pieces are defined between the split grooves, the top end of each of the tightening pieces forms a clamping jaw on the inner side, the tightening ring is sleeved on the sleeve section of the rubber sleeve, the clamping jaws of the tightening pieces are buckled and limited in the buckling ring groove, and the inner diameter of the top end of the sleeve cylinder forms a tapered hole that is tapered from bottom to top, the tapered hole is used to press and tighten the tightening pieces of the tightening ring, so that the clamping jaws clamp the buckling ring groove of the rubber sleeve, and the rubber sleeve is retracted and tightly fitted to the outer diameter of the cable.

[0009] Preferably, the outer edge of the top end of each of the tightening pieces of the tightening ring is provided with a guide slope.

[0010] Preferably, the shaft sleeve hole of the rubber sleeve forms a tapered hole that is tapered from bottom to top, and the angle difference between the top end and the bottom end of the shaft sleeve hole is between 2 degrees and 5 degrees.

[0011] Preferably, a ring protrusion is arranged on the inner wall of the sleeve hole of the rubber sleeve relative to the position of the leakage-proof section.

[0012] Preferably, the inner wall of the sleeve hole of the rubber sleeve is formed as a convex arc surface, and the bottom end of the sleeve hole has a larger diameter than the top end.

[0013] Preferably, the outer edge end surface of the leakage-proof section of the rubber sleeve is a flat surface or an arc surface.

[0014] The beneficial effects of the present application are that the connector is stably connected to the cable through the buckling combination of the connecting outer cylinder and the sleeve cylinder, which helps to improve the success rate of the assembly of the connector and the cable, greatly reduces the risk of failure of the connector combination, and has the characteristics of low structure cost, easy assembly, durability, and practicality of the structure.

[0015] The buckle section of the connecting outer cylinder utilizes the split groove to form a plurality of elastic buckling pieces, and utilizes the design characteristics of the non-straight sleeve hole of the rubber sleeve, so that when the rubber sleeve is assembled along the cable 11 and is combined into the inner diameter of the buckle section, the buckle section is expanded by the rubber sleeve, so that when the sleeve cylinder covers the buckle section and is buckled and fixed, the buckle tightness of the sleeve cylinder can be ensured through the stretched buckle section, and the concern that the cable is separated from the connector is avoided.

[0016] The outer support of the leakage-proof section of the rubber sleeve is attached to the inside of the sleeve cylinder, which can effectively prevent water pressure from entering and greatly improve the waterproof effect. B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F DRAWINGS

[0055] The present application will be further described with reference to the drawings and specific examples, so that those skilled in the art can better understand the present application and implement it.

[0056] First, please refer to Figures 1 to 4 As shown in the figure, a connector cable waterproof covering structure, which comprises: a connector 10, connecting a cable 11; a connection outer cylinder 20, which is arranged around the outer periphery of the cable 11 and is assembled and fixed to the end of the connector 10, and the end of the connection outer cylinder 20 away from the connector 10 forms a buckle section 21, the buckle section 21 is provided with a plurality of split grooves 211 along the axial direction at the end, and the buckle section 21 forms a plurality of elastic clamping pieces 212, the outer surface of the elastic clamping piece 212 is provided with a plurality of buckle ribs 213 along the radial direction, and the inner diameter of the buckle section 21 forms an expanded hole and has a step 214, so that the inner diameter of the buckle section 21 and the cable 11 has a combined ring groove 22; a rubber sleeve 30, the inner diameter of the rubber sleeve 30 forms a non-straight cylindrical shaft sleeve hole 31, one end of the outer diameter of the rubber sleeve 30 is provided with a connecting section 32, the upper end of the connecting section 32 is provided with a leak stop section 33, the outer diameter of the leak stop section 33 is larger than that of the connecting section 32, and the inner diameter of the shaft sleeve hole 31 at the position opposite to the leak stop section 33 is smaller than that at the position opposite to the connecting section 32, and the upper end of the leak stop section 33 forms a sleeve section 34, the outer diameter of the sleeve section 34 is smaller than that of the leak stop section 33, and the upper half of the sleeve section 34 is provided with a buckling ring groove 341, and the upper end of the buckling ring groove 341 further forms a lead-in section 35 with an outer diameter smaller than that of the sleeve section 34; a tightening ring 40, the periphery of the tightening ring 40 is provided with a plurality of split grooves 41 at equal intervals, and a plurality of tightening pieces 42 are defined between the split grooves 41, the top end of each tightening piece 42 forms a clamping jaw 421 on the inner side, and the outer edge of the top end of each tightening piece 42 is provided with a guide inclined surface 422; a sleeve 50, which passes through the cable 11 and the buckle combination of the connection outer cylinder 20, the bottom end of the sleeve 50 is provided with a plurality of buckle slot holes 51 penetrating the inner and outer diameter surfaces, and is buckled and fixed with the buckle ribs 213 of the connection outer cylinder 20 through the buckle slot holes 51, the inner diameter of the top end of the sleeve 50 forms a tapered hole 52 from bottom to top, which is used to extrude and tighten the tightening pieces 42 of the tightening ring 40.

[0057] The structure of the composition, please refer to Figure 3 、 Figure 5 、 Figure 6 、 Figure 7 、 Figure 8As shown, the connecting outer cylinder 20 is fixed at the end of the connector 10 and is arranged around the cable 11. The sleeve segment 34 of the rubber sleeve 30 is sleeved on the tightening ring 40, and the clamping jaw 421 of the clamping piece 42 is inserted into the buckling ring groove 341, and then the rubber sleeve 30 is tightly sleeved on the cable 11 through the shaft sleeve hole 31, and the connecting segment 32 is arranged in the combined ring groove 22 of the connecting outer cylinder 20 relative to the inner diameter of the buckling segment 21. Thus, the rubber sleeve 30 is sleeved on the cable 11 by using the non-cylindrical design characteristics of the shaft sleeve hole 31, so that the outer diameter of the rubber sleeve 30 can be further expanded outward, and the elastic buckling piece 212 of the buckling segment 21 is further pushed out, and the leakage stopping segment 33 is abutted against the end of the connecting outer cylinder 20. Then, the sleeve cylinder 50 is assembled along the cable 11 to the connecting outer cylinder 20. When the sleeve cylinder 50 passes through the rubber sleeve 30, the elastic buckling piece 212 of the connecting outer cylinder 20 can be further extruded by the material characteristics of the rubber sleeve 30, and the buckling groove hole 51 and the buckling rib 213 are further buckled and fixed. Thus, by the characteristics that the rubber sleeve 30 is expanded outward to push out the elastic buckling piece 212, the sleeve cylinder 50 and the connecting outer cylinder can be tightly matched to prevent the sleeve cylinder 50 from falling off. The leakage stopping segment 33 of the rubber sleeve 30 is also expanded outward to tightly abut against the inner wall of the sleeve cylinder 50, and can also fill the buckling groove hole 51 which is not buckled around the sleeve cylinder 50, so as to effectively buffer the water pressure impact and achieve the waterproof purpose.

[0058] In addition, when the sleeve cylinder 50 is buckled and fixed with the connecting outer cylinder 20, the tapered hole 52 of the inner diameter of the sleeve cylinder 50 extrudes each clamping piece 42 of the tightening ring 40 along the guide inclined surface 422, so that the clamping jaw 421 further clamps the buckling ring groove 341 of the rubber sleeve 30 inward, and the rubber sleeve 30 is retracted and tightly abuts against the outer diameter of the cable 11, which helps to improve the tightness and waterproof effect of the cable 11.

[0059] The sh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is shown in Figure 1(a). Figure 4 As shown, the sh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is a tapered hole formed from bottom to top, and the angle difference between the top end and the bottom end of the shaft sleeve hole 31 is between 2 degrees and 5 degrees.

[0060] The sh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is shown in Figure 1(b). Figure 9 As shown, the inner wall of the sh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is further provided with a ring protrusion 311 relative to the position of the leakage stopping segment 33, which helps to increase the outward expansion range of the leakage stopping segment 33 of the rubber sleeve 30 and improve the waterproof effect between the connecting outer cylinder 20 and the sleeve cylinder 50.

[0061] The sh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is shown in Figure 1(c). Figure 10As shown, the inner wall of the sh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is formed as a convex arc surface 312, and the bottom end of the shaft sleeve hole 31 has a larger diameter than the top end.

[0062] The outer edge end surface of the leakproof section of the rubber sleeve 30 is a flat surface (as shown in Figure 4 ) or an arc surface (as shown in Figure 11 ).

[0063] The above-mentioned specific embodiments have the following benefits: the connector 10 is stably connected to the cable 11 by the buckle combination of the connecting outer cylinder 20 and the fitting cylinder 50, which helps to improve the success rate of the assembly of the connector 10 and the cable 11, greatly reduces the risk of failure of the combination of the connector 10, and has the characteristics of low structure cost, easy assembly, durability, and the like, and retains the practicability of the structure.

[0064] Furthermore, the buckle section 21 of the connecting outer cylinder 20 is formed with a plurality of elastic buckling pieces 212 by the slot 211, and the non-cylindrical shaft sleeve hole 31 of the rubber sleeve 30 is designed to have the characteristics that when the rubber sleeve 30 is assembled along the cable 11 and is combined into the inner diameter of the buckle section 21, the buckle section 21 is expanded by the rubber sleeve 30, so that when the fitting cylinder 50 covers and buckles the buckle section 21, the buckle tightness of the fitting cylinder 50 can be ensured by the expanded buckle section 21, and the concern that the cable 11 is separated from the connector 10 is avoided.

[0065] The outer support of the leakproof section 33 of the rubber sleeve 30 is attached to the inside of the fitting cylinder 50, which can effectively prevent water pressure from entering and greatly improve the waterproof effect.
